The Company
Ecovantage are experts in energy auditing, certificates, engineering and schemes. Ecovantage specialise in sustainable energy management and auditing for commercial and industrial organisations, and small to medium enterprises, enabling energy efficiency incentives for all Australians. As one of Australia's oldest, largest and most versatile Accredited Certificate Providers, Ecovantage provides clients access to all federal and state energy certificates. Their accredited services range from strategic consulting and scheme compliance, to the recommendation of incentivised energy‑saving technologies, all providing a financially viable path to a more sustainable future. Ecovantage's team offers Energy Audits and Assessments, NABERS ratings, carbon neutral certification through Climate Active, Measurement & Verification services, as well as in‑house compliance, certificate generation and trading for all Australian Carbon Credits, Renewable Energy Certificates and White Certificates. Established in 2007, Ecovantage is proud to be certified Climate Active carbon neutral for its business operations, and has passionate employees across its offices in Victoria, South Australia, New South Wales and Queensland.
